Driving without a license is illegal in every state, but most states differentiate between operating a vehicle without a valid drivers license and driving a vehicle without proof of a drivers license (such as when a driver fails to physically carry their valid drivers license). An individual shall not cause or knowingly permit any minor to drive a motor vehicle upon a highway as an operator, unless the minor has first obtained a license to drive a motor vehicle under the provisions of this chapter.
